texte = >>Ken, >> >>The revised lookup doesn't seem to work any better; it still returns 0. >>BTW, the lookup is >> >>[format .2f][lookup >>db=formulas.db&value=ShipCost&lookinfield=Name&returnfield=Formula¬found=No >>ne >>][/format] >> >>I'm fairly new with [lookup]s and haven't messed with them. Does this look >>right? > >Yes, it looks right to me. And I didn't really think my formula would work >any better than the one you already had, I just thought it might be worth >a try, in case there was some strange problem in the math context I had >never seen. Just make sure the value (ShipCost) is entered exactly because >lookups are case sensitive with respect to the value parameter.db=formulas.db&value=ShipCost&lookinfield=Name&returnfield=Formula¬found=No ^^^^^^^^^Isn't this a value from a [Search]? If so it should read [ShipCost] instead of just ShipCost. ************************************************************* Christer Olsson Stora Nygatan 21 Phone +46 40 791 50 Art director S-211 37 Malmoe Fax +46 40 97 99 77 Ljusa Ideer AB Sweden http://www.ljusaideer.se Associated Messages, from the most recent to the oldest:
